How to Access Ethereum on Revolut
Purchasing Ethereum on the platform is designed to be intuitive. Follow these steps to get started:
- Account Funding: Ensure your primary Revolut account is funded in your local currency. The platform supports over 30 global currencies, making it highly accessible internationally.
- Navigation: Locate the Crypto tab within the application dashboard. This section serves as the hub for all digital asset activity.
- Selection: Search for Ethereum (ETH) among the extensive list of available tokens. Revolut currently hosts hundreds of different crypto assets, including Ethereum Classic (ETC) and various altcoins.
- Execution: Once you have selected Ethereum, you can choose to buy a specific amount. The app will display the current exchange rate and any applicable fees before you confirm your transaction.
Important Considerations for Investors
While the convenience of buying Ethereum on Revolut is unmatched for casual users, there are several factors to keep in mind:
Custodial Nature: When you buy Ethereum through Revolut, the platform holds the assets for you. This is known as a custodial service. While this simplifies security, it is different from holding coins in a private, non-custodial wallet where you possess the private keys.
Fee Structure: Revolut charges a fee for crypto transactions. It is essential to review the current pricing plan associated with your specific account tier, as fees can vary based on whether you are on a Standard, Plus, Premium, or Metal plan.
Market Volatility: Cryptocurrency markets are notoriously volatile. The value of your Ethereum can fluctuate rapidly. Always ensure that you are investing capital that you are comfortable potentially losing.
Why Choose Revolut for Crypto?
The primary advantage of using Revolut is its ecosystem. Because your crypto holdings are integrated with your daily banking, you can easily track your net worth, set up price alerts, and even schedule recurring buys. This “dollar-cost averaging” strategy is highly recommended for long-term investors looking to mitigate the risks associated with market timing.
